I've reproduced your problem. I installed Fedora-Workstation-Live-x86_64-25-1.3.iso
on a system, then did;
sudo dnf groupinstall sugar-desktop
.
Starting Terminal and typing sugar
did not work. Prompt returned with no error, but exit status 1. Looking at log file .sugar/default/logs/shell.log
there is a missing package, which could be fixed with;
sudo dnf install webkitgtk3
Caused by the Fedora package of Sugar not declaring a dependency. After start, sugar
did work once.
But on logout gdm would not show a Sugar desktop entry, and the GNOME desktop would no longer work. It would not start, as you saw.
After applying all updates with dnf update
, the login screen gdm itself would not work.
